Cares Sexual Wellness Services is a dedicated agency in Southwest Michigan that offers free health and wellness resources, with a focus on comprehensive sexual health. Their mission is to create an inclusive environment that empowers individuals to navigate their sexual wellness journey without shame, stigma, or judgment.

The organization provides a range of zero-cost services, including STI testing, HIV testing, PrEP access, and more, while also ensuring specialty case management for those living with HIV. With a commitment to affirming care for all queer, trans, gay, and gender non-conforming individuals, Cares strives to meet the needs of the community with compassion and respect.

On Sunday, September 26, 2010, AIDS Walk Michigan ' Lansing/East Lansing will be held at Valley Court Park in East Lansing ( behind People's Church ). Registration begins at 10: 00 AM and the AIDS Walk will kickoff at 1: 00 PM. Officially hosted by Evans Scholars of Michigan State University for the past 14 years, the local service oriented fraternity provides extensive assistance in all phases of the fundraising event. Their support and enthusiasm for this event and their commitment to LAAN and the AIDS Walk has become an annual tradition and has forged a unique partnership in the local effort to raise awareness and funding to stop the further spread of HIV. AIDS Walk Michigan is a non-profit organization that began in 1998 to raise awareness of HIV and AIDS, and to raise money for AIDS services in participating Michigan communities. Funds for AIDS Walk Michigan come from a variety of sources. Individuals and teams participating in the 5k Walk ask for pledges from friends, family members and their communities. Corporate contributions and sponsorships ( cash or in-kind donations ) from area businesses are also donated. In addition, hundreds of companies, churches and organizations from across Michigan raise funds to lend a hand. The funds generated by each AIDS Walk are dedicated to HIV/AIDS education, prevention and services. It is important to know that all of the money collected by a community remains in that community to support its local AIDS services. Some local agencies direct all the monies donated to a single service agency, while others divide their proceeds among more than one agency. The local agencies that benefit from AIDS Walk Michigan serve nearly 60% of the 16, 500 Michigan residents living with HIV and AIDS. For some HIV/AIDS service organizations, the Walk is their primary fundraising event.
